Construction will be complete and operations are expected to commence by year-end 2027.
The project will create approximately 1000 jobs during construction. Hiring will ramp up over the approximately 2-year construction timeframe. The project aims to provide local job opportunities to qualified candidates wherever possible.
The EPC provider, SOLV, will collaborate with local unions to facilitate hiring opportunities in compliance with applicable labor laws and agreements. Per state tax and project contractual requirements, employees working on the construction of the facility will be paid at least 175 percent of the average statewide hourly wage and will receive health insurance coverage for themselves and their dependents.
Construction-related vehicles and workers traveling to and from the site will temporarily increase traffic. Efforts will be made to minimize disruptions to the community, including set hours for workers to travel to and from the site and encouraging carpooling.
SB Energy has a track record of improving roads where we operate. Road improvements will be made before, during, and after construction. This will include widening, stabilizing, and maintaining roads used during construction and final paving of the main access road once construction is completed.
SB Energy is committed to protecting communities and minimizing impacts during construction across all our projects. In compliance with local and federal permits, the project will follow best practices during construction for dust suppression, implement traffic management plans, and enforce work-hour restrictions to limit disruptions to the community.
No water will be used to generate electricity during operations, and minimal water will be used during construction for dust suppression.
The project has a Power Purchase Agreement with NV Energy to help serve the energy needs of its Nevada customers. The power will connect to the electric grid in Lyon County and flow to the nearest connected loads, including Mineral and Lyon Counties, as well as other areas of Nevada.
